Touch automation / Fill Loop not returning to initial value

This issue persists for several versions and years:

  • an automation lane with no automation data
  • start writing automation in touch mode
  • when you stop writing automation, the value should return to the initial value, but it doesn´t

This is true for touch automation and for automation with “fill loop” turned on.

The manual states:
“When no automation data exists for a particular parameter, the starting point of an
automation pass is saved as the initial value. When you punch out of the automation pass, it
is this initial value to which the parameter will return.”

So this clearly is a bug.

There is an official workaround on the Cubase Youtube Channel by Greg Ondo:
https://www.youtube.com/watch?v=ut4rLr3eslE

And there are several reports about this topic over the last years, e.g.:

https://www.steinberg.net/forums/viewtopic.php?f=253&t=120729&p=656348&hilit=fill+loop#p656348
https://www.steinberg.net/forums/viewtopic.php?f=253&t=121397&p=658895&hilit=fill+loop#p658895

I think it is time to fix this bug.

Hi,

There is different behaviour in Cubase and Nuendo. In Nuendo it works as you expected.

Thank you EFF for the detailed documentation and link to the workaround. I can confirm that this is still an issue.